Douglas Drive Senior Citizens Centre
Douglas Drive is a Day Centre for Senior Citizens from Stevenage and surrounding villages.
Activities
Our aim is to enrich the social lives of Senior Citizens and help to prevent isolation by meeting in groups of like-minded people.
At present we provide two general day care groups which are held on Mondays and Wednesdays and a third group on Tuesdays, is a mixed group including general day care and Stroke Survivors.
Douglas Drive are a Dementia friendly organisation and therefore will also welcome clients with early to moderate stage of Dementia
Activities suitable for each group are organised and delivered by our activities co-ordinator assisted by our volunteers.
A two-course meal cooked at the centre is provided daily for a nominal charge as part of the Day Care session.
The centre is run by a voluntary management committee and 5 part-time paid staff.
We also have many regular volunteers who generously give their time to help us provide the service we are proud of.
Douglas Drive SCA is a non-profit making registered charity who operate from a building owned by Stevenage Borough Council.
In addition to funding from the Community Wellbeing Team we also raise money from grants applications and donations, all of which helps towards paying the running costs of the centre.
